Transaction ed6d530ebce8d6ea29a5e0ee26f3a7f4a8e2201ed8fc76c5b9c2ae65b3981b72

1 Input
1 Outputs
  • ed6d530ebce8d6ea29a5e0ee26f3a7f4a8e2201ed8fc76c5b9c2ae65b3981b72:0
  • value  49990251
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z